    HEAD:
    1: In a magic ring crochet 6 single crochet.
    2: increase in every multiple of 2, i mean 2 single crochet in the 6 single crochet you did before. [12 stitches]
    3: increase in every multiple of 3. 1 sc, one increase. [18]
    4: increase in every multiple of 4. 2 sc, one increase. [24]
    5: increase in every multiple of 5. 3 sc, one increase. [30]
    Do 5 more rows of only single crochets.
    DECREASE.
    11: invisible decrease in every multiple of 5.
    12: invisible decrease in every multiple of 4
    13: invisible decrease in every multiple of 3
    14: invisible decrease in every multiple of 2
    Then you will have 6 stitches there so you cut the yarn and leave a long strip and with the yarn noodle you take only front part of your stiches and pull it and it will close nice. Search a tutorial if you don't understand something.
    note: increase are two single crochet in the same stitch.
    BODY (LEGS)
    1: in a magic ring you do 6 single crochet and close it.
    2-4: single crochets rows (you can do 3 or 4 rows)
    Then you join the 2 legs and crochet as you normally do. I increase in the lateral sides, like 2 times. And did like 5 or 6 rows. I decrease in the lateral sides one time for the neck (?) like Mio said.
    EARS:
    In a magic ring crochet 6, a then increase in every stitch until you have 12 stitches.
    You can glue or sew them.
    For the belly? Well you can crochet an oval or use felt.

    I wrote out the pattern as requested by another fan of Mio. It may not be perfect since I'm not the best at writing patterns and as Mio said herself, there isn't really a distinctive pattern for this one so it's a lot of eyeballing.
    2.75 mm Hook
    Working in joined rounds
    Anything in* bold* means to repeat until the end of each round
    Remember to chain 1 at the beginning of each new round
    Head:
    Chain 2 and start crocheting into the first chain to create the round shape of this pattern (or Magic Ring!)
    Round 1: 6 Single Crochet (Abbreviated SC) into the chain as explained above. Slip Stitch to join (Abbreviated S2J)
    Round 3-???: Since Mio didn't use any specific pattern here, *SC in the first three-four SC, INC in next*. Repeat this round as many times as you'd like. The video seems to have this repeated about 6-7 times for a total of what looks like 9 rounds. S2J as always.
    Round ???+1: Repeat round 3-??? but backwards. So if you were crocheting three SC and then INC, crochet three SC and either decrease or skip a SC like Mio is doing. Both work well for this pattern! Repeat this method until you have a ball for the head. Remember to stuff when the hole is closing quickly to prevent bunching and bursting.
    End of Head.
    Feet/Arms (Make 4):
    Chain 2 and start crocheting into the first chain to create the round shape of this pattern (or Magic Ring!)
    Round 1: 6 SC into the chain as explained above. S2J (Abbreviated S2J)
    Round 2-4: *SC in each SC*. Fasten Off three of the Feet/Arms when crocheting BUT NOT THE LAST ONE. You will need this to make the body.
    End of Feet.
    Body:
    We're going to join the two feet together. With the foot still attached, we will be using the yarn as provided. Choose a random stitch on the other foot and slip stitch the two feet together.
    Round 1: Chain 1, *SC around each SC (this means of both feet together, thus making them directly crocheted on to the body!)*
    Round 2-5: You need to eyeball this. INC and DEC as you see fit to make the body shape. I would recommend to form little hips with expanding once or twice and work your way up, perhaps decreasing a little to form more of the stomach area. This part is totally up to you and see what you like.
    -You want the body to be about the same size as the head. Stuff and fasten off, there will be a large gap at the top of the body.
    End of Body.
    Ears (Make 2 of everything below: total of 6 pieces)
    For the brown: Create these like you have been starting off the head. I would say stop at about round 3. Again, this is eyeballed and requires your judgment based off the size of the head.
    For the yellow: Do the same as for the brown part of the ear, but make these 1 round smaller as to nestle in the brown part. Make these as well with 1 round to be the bottoms of the feet.
    All assembly is in the video. Happy crocheting!
